Democratic state AGs to sue over Trump's freeze on grants, loans


Published on 2025-01-28 16:20:46 - MSN
  Print publication without navigation

  • A group of Democratic state attorneys general said they plan to ask a court on Tuesday to block the Trump administration's sweeping directive to temporarily freeze federal loans, grants and other financial assistance.

The article from MSN discusses how a group of Democratic state attorneys general are preparing to sue the Trump administration over its decision to freeze funding for several key programs, including grants and loans. This action targets the administration's move to withhold funds from states and cities that limit cooperation with federal immigration enforcement, known as "sanctuary" jurisdictions. The lawsuit aims to challenge the legality of the funding freeze, arguing that it improperly withholds federal funds from states and cities, potentially affecting public safety, education, and other critical services. The attorneys general assert that this executive overreach not only threatens the welfare of their constituents but also violates constitutional principles by attempting to coerce local governments into changing their policies on immigration enforcement.
